haggler
English
Etymology
haggle +? -er
Noun
haggler (plural hagglers)
- A person who haggles.
- (formerly) A person who buys vegetables and other produce from farms and then sells them on in a different location; a person who transports farm goods.

higgler
English
Etymology
higgle +? -er
Pronunciation
- (UK) IPA(key): /?h??l?/
Noun
higgler (plural higglers)
- (archaic) An itinerant trader, especially one dealing in dairy produce and poultry.
- 1749, Henry Fielding, Tom Jones, Book III ch x:
- He was, besides, the best sacrifice the higgler could make, as he had supplied him with no game since; and by this means the witness had an opportunity of screening his better customers:
- 1828, JT Smith, Nollekens and His Times, Century Hutchinson 1986, p. 64:
- [E]very poulterer in the neighbourhood had repeatedly refused her custom […] so that her only means of procuring poultry was of the higglers: their fowls, she found out, were either so ill fed, or of such an enormous age, that there was no gravy to follow the knife […] .
- 1749, Henry Fielding, Tom Jones, Book III ch x:
- A person who haggles or negotiates for lower prices.
- (Jamaican) A seller of any kind of small produce or wares; a huckster.
